No doubt some of you will recognise some of these firms at Dover 1980s.
Oily
Yes, Oily! At the top I-spy Denby, Tracto and Merzario trailers. In the middle I-spy a Jumbo Merc, an Edmonson Merc, Cavewood and MAT. At the bottom I-spy a Sties F12 from Norway, at least 3 ER-SEN Fiats from Turkey, a Hungarocamion Merc, Ferrymasters and CTR.
I can also see a 3-axle Scania 112 with a roped and sheeted load next to the little hut, that looks as if it belongs to East Kent Enterprises. And if that pic was taken in 1985/6 it might well be me at the wheel! Robert
